While treadmills might appear uncomplicated, different types accommodate different needs and choices. Here are the primary categories:

Manual Treadmills: These require no power and are propelled by the user's effort. They typically take up less space and are quieter however can provide a steeper learning curve for novices.

Electric or Motorized Treadmills: The most typical type, they feature automated programs for speed and incline. They are generally more versatile however require electrical energy to operate.

Folding Treadmills: Designed for those with limited space, folding treadmills can be collapsed and kept away when not in use, making them perfect for small homes.

Incline Treadmills: These machines offer the ability to raise the slope, mimicing hill runs for a more reliable exercise.

Business Treadmills: Built for heavy use, these machines are generally found in health clubs and gym and come with a variety of features and toughness.

A1: It is generally advised to utilize a treadmill at least 3 times per week for 30-60 minutes to see considerable outcomes.
Q2: Can I reduce weight using a treadmill?
A2: Yes, with a combination of regular workout, a well balanced diet plan, and part control, utilizing a treadmill electric can contribute greatly to weight loss.
Q3: Do I require to warm-up before utilizing the treadmill?
A3: Yes, warming up is necessary to prepare your body, minimize the danger of injury, and enhance exercise efficiency.
Q4: Is operating on a treadmill as efficient as running outdoors?
A4: Both have benefits, but a treadmill enables regulated environments, avoiding weather-related disturbances, and might have less effect on the joints.
Q5: Can a treadmill aid with muscle building?
A5: While mainly a cardiovascular tool, adjusting inclines can assist engage and enhance specific leg muscles.
